A style of marinating meat native to Jamaica, jerk is made with allspice and Scotch bonnet peppers, and its name is believed to be Spanish, derived from the Peruvian word charqui, meaning dried strips of meat. The meat is grilled, and the resulting flavours and aromas are deliciously smoky and spicy.

Cross the wealthy flavor of rib-eye steak with tender beef tenderloin and you get hanger steak, a tasty cut of beef that hangs from the diaphragm of the cow along the plate, or lower belly. Due to the fact this muscle does incredibly small work, it is exceptionally tender and packed with beefy flavor. Property cooks may well be intimidated by this significantly less prevalent reduce, but cooking it is in fact much much easier than cooking a tenderloin or ribeye.

In the early 1970s, Martha Rosler wrote The Art of Cooking, a mock dialogue amongst Julia Child and then New York Instances restaurant critic Craig Claiborne. Here published in complete for the initial time, it consists in significant component of quotations from books on cuisine and cooking from numerous eras redirected toward a discussion of the part of taste in art. Right after operating at restaurants such as Bouley, Maxim’s in New York and Chanterelle, Lo ran her own restaurant, the Michelin-starred Annisa in the heart of Manhattan’s Greenwich Village, from 2000 until last year. She has appeared on Top Chef Masters, Iron Chef America and Chopped. And in 2015, she became the initially female guest chef to cook at the White House.
